Creators of the Alien Assault series who create freeware titles. Other titles: The Main Attraction, Office Ninjas and Snow Rescue. On December 16, 2012 devs released Alien Assault sequel, Left to Die. Their next project is Alien Assault 2.


There are no registered leaders of this group. This can be granted to the right person on request. Also why don't you join the community, we welcome creators and consumers alike and look forward to your comments.